This study examines the perceived effect of idealized media images on self and classmates for three levels of outcome undesirability: perception of ideal body weight, effect on self-esteem, and likelihood of developing an eating disorder. A significant third-person effect was observed, which widened as the outcome increased in social undesirability. Those with high self-esteem exhibited stronge...

When faced with shame, children can either respond in submissive ways to withdraw from their environment or in externalizing ways to oppose their environment. This study tested the hypothesis that fragile-positive views of self predispose children to respond in externalizing ways to shame situations.
